Noctrix Health is redefining the treatment of chronic neurological disorders with clinically validated therapeutic wearables. Our team of medical device specialists, neuroscientists, and consumer electronics engineers is dedicated to delivering prescription-grade therapy with an outstanding user experience.
We have pioneered the world’s first drug-free wearable therapy, clinically proven to alleviate symptoms in adults with drug-resistant Restless Legs Syndrome (RLS). Be part of our mission to transform healthcare, improve lives, and drive meaningful change with Noctrix Health .
The Territory Sales Manager will drive sales and market awareness. You will be responsible for building and executing a high-growth strategy across multiple states. Your focus will be on prescribing healthcare providers, hospitals, and patients. This position reports to the US Vice President of Sales and Field Operations at Noctrix Health .
